The class was actually super interesting, IMO. The course name made me think it would be kind of boring, but it was one of my favorite classes this semester. The professor is super kind and cares about her students. If you're struggling, she has compassion. The course grades are four exams and a final paper. She introduces the final paper assignment at the beginning of the semester and will give additional notes throughout the semester as the lecture material pertains to it. She offered to look through rough drafts of this assignment a few weeks before the due date, and she helps you outline the project well before it's due. The exams were non-cumulative until the Final. They are all true/false with two short answer response questions. She goes over what the short answer response questions are in (at the latest) the class before the exam, and offers to read your answers and provide feedback before the exam. She basically does everything in her power to help you succeed, but since there are only five grades for the whole class you need to put in the work. Go to class! Take notes on the lectures, read the assigned readings, go to office hours, ask her questions, and keep up with the term paper. The biggest drawback in the class is there are A LOT of readings, so it can be easy to get overwhelmed and behind. The exams draw heavily from the readings though, so you can't really skip out on them. Definitely recommend :)

Anyone who tells you to take Dr. Velez is either a teacher's pet or doesn't know their right from their left. Yes, she is a nice person, but I'm here to get an education not meet nice people. How anyone can make the time to read everything she assigns and stay on top of their other classes is beyond me. What really stinks is how useless her lectures are. All she does is read off a PowerPoint, which is posted online anyway. This class relies heavily on YOU doing the work, and her serving as a manager to go consult if you have any issues. What is the purpose of having an instructor who doesn't instruct? It is utterly disgusting that this education is costing money and yet a book (which costs money again) is teaching me these subjects. If you want to learn what's being taught in this class, just go buy the textbook and read it - nothing additional will be gained from instruction. Now the class structure. Jeez. 3 exams, 1 big boy writing assignment and that's it. The exams go into detail on the readings that only someone with a photographic memory could recall. They are hard and consist of true/false and short answer questions. Maybe the only good thing about the exams is you usually get a look ahead of what the short answer questions are so you can "prepare your answer." The writing assignment is fine, and honestly not horrible. What I can say for sure is DO NOT TAKE THIS CLASS. Just don't. Her average gpa in this class is 2.61 for a reason. This course was awful, Dr. Velez was unfortunately a very poor professor, and my grade and future suffer because of that. Big no no.

Dr Velez is a good teacher because she genuinely cares about her student's learning and grades. The class is hard, and there's a lot of reading and the exams have very specific questions, but the material is interesting and really important if you want to go into the criminal justice field. I honestly think everyone should be required to take this class. There's also a paper that's worth 30% of your grade and I found it really confusing at first, but she'll review it for you as much as you want before it's due so you can get lots of feedback and if you work with her you can get a 100% on it. I did poorly on the exams (my fault tbh) but the A on the paper saved my grade because I continued to get feedback from her throughout.
